2. The service
CliniqFlow provides patient intake forms, demographic and symptom collection, intake questionnaires, rule-based intake structuring, and AI-assisted documentation and clinical decision-support. Outputs are draft documentation for licensed practitioner review. CliniqFlow is not an EHR, telehealth platform, insurance platform, prescription platform, treatment management platform, or appointment scheduling system.
Features may vary by plan and may change over time. Beta or preview features are offered as-is and may be modified or discontinued.
